How to Reach
While Belur Math is a bit of a walk from the metro, it's still your best bet to avoid Kolkata's traffic. Many visitors take an auto-rickshaw for the last stretch.
Board the metro line
Look for trains heading towards Howrah Maidan. Check the display boards for confirmation.
Get off at Howrah Maidan
The station is well-marked. Use the main exit towards the street level.
Head to Belur Math
Around 45 minutes walking. Consider a shared auto (₹20-30) if you prefer.
Prefer not to walk? Auto-rickshaws and cabs are available right outside Howrah Maidan station. Negotiate the fare before you hop in, or use Uber/Ola for fixed pricing.
About Belur Math
Belur Math holds spiritual significance for devotees and visitors alike. Situated in Howrah, this sacred space offers a moment of peace amidst Kolkata's urban rush. Many locals visit here regularly, and first-time visitors often find the atmosphere unexpectedly calming.
Howrah Maidan metro station is the closest to Belur Math, though you'll want to factor in the 45-minute walk (or grab an auto). It's not the shortest commute, but the metro still beats sitting in Kolkata traffic.

Visitor Guidelines
✓Do's
- Remove footwear before entering
- Dress conservatively
- Maintain silence in prayer areas
- Follow queue systems patiently
✕Don'ts
- Take photos where prohibited
- Wear revealing clothing
- Disturb those who are praying
- Bring leather items into temples
